On the night of December 20, a night of boxing will be held in Miami, the main event of which will be a heavyweight confrontation between the former world champion Anthony Joshua (28–4, 25 KO) and an American Jake Paul (12–1, 7 KO).
On Friday, November 21, the organizers of the show announced the list of fights that will take place on the undercard:
- the ex-absolute world champion in women’s featherweight, the American Alicia Baumgardner (16–1, 7 KOs) will meet with the contender from Canada Leila Boden (13–1, 2 KOs).
- former UFC champions will meet in the ring and fight in the contract weight (up to 88.5 kg) – 50-year-old Anderson Silva from Brazil and 43-year-old Tyron Woodley.
- sexy absolute women’s bantamweight champion Cerneka Johnson (18–2, 8 KO) from Australia will fight Amanda Halle (12–0–1, 1 KO) from Canada.
- WBC women’s bantamweight champion Jocasta Valle (33-3, 10 KOs) from Costa Rica will fight against American Yadira Bustillos (11-1, 2 KOs).
- in the welterweight division, there will be a fight between the representatives of the USA – Avius Griffin (17-1, 16 KOs) against Justin Cardona (10-1, 5 KOs).
- 2024 Olympic contender Keno Merli of Brazil will make his cruiserweight debut against Dairra Davis Jr. (2–1, 1 KO).
Jake Paul was scheduled to enter the ring on November 14 against his compatriot Jervonta Davis, but the fight was canceled due to “The Tank” being accused of beating his girlfriend. For this reason, the show was postponed to December, and Jake’s new opponent was the ex-champion from Britain.
